We had a flat tire Sunday morning (1/6/24). After church, we removed the flat and I took the tire to Walmart because we had purchased it there. The intake technician looked at the tire and said the screw was too close to the side wall and they couldn't plug or patch the tire. He looked up my phone number and found our tire information. He told me "It is covered by the road hazard warranty." He took the tire in the shop and instructed me on where to park and wait. He made NO mention of partial coverage or out of pocket cost. Nothing! An hour later, a different technician walked to my truck and said the tire was ready. I followed him inside just to be given a bill for $121.68. They made no attempt to call me or come to the truck and tell me how much it would cost before performing the work, they just changed the tire, and gave me a bill. All I was told before getting the bill was "It is covered by the road hazard warranty." They made No attempt to tell me how much it would cost before performing the work. Needless to say, I'm very upset. Resolution Sought I would like a full reimbursement of the $121.68. They wasted my time waiting on the tire that they said was covered under warranty. They performed the work without my agreement to pay anything extra. They then said the only options I had was pay the $121.68 or wait even longer for them to put the old tire back on. If they had told me up front how much it was going to cost, I could have made an informed decision. You just don't change tires without telling people how much it will cost!
